Output 6662ade1d8f210f51491e16521e14f7037bd40773b6eb2e4ed1a24608c598b91:0

value
724000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ef868f6c7a90325bd871e923b2156233cb111b OP_EQUAL
address
39hyemLaJZGSSAXfPh5RBBhbKHtfLAyHf2
transaction
6662ade1d8f210f51491e16521e14f7037bd40773b6eb2e4ed1a24608c598b91
spent
true